U+1F37A "🍺" Beer Mug Unicode Character
Unicode Version 17.0
U+1F37A "🍺" Beer Mug is a pictographic symbol representing a foaming, golden beverage in a traditional handled glass mug, commonly used in digital communication to denote beer, drinking, pubs, celebrations, or social gatherings. Added to the Unicode Standard in 2010 as part of Unicode 6.0 under the Miscellaneous Symbols and Pictographs block, it belongs to the broader category of food and drink emojis and is widely supported across platforms and devices. The design often varies by operating system, with most versions depicting a frothy, amber liquid inside a clear or tinted mug, sometimes with a distinct handle and a thick white foam head, making it instantly recognizable in messaging, social media, and online content for conveying a casual or festive mood.
